Some key responsibilities:

* To provide housing management and housing related support to a caseload of residents
* To be responsible for the monitoring of all rent accounts ensuring that both personal and housing benefit elements are paid regularly – taking early intervention and prevention action to minimise rent arrears, only taking enforcement action when necessary
* Work collaboratively with other departments – in particular, Facilities and Property Management and other community operations teams (Health and Well-being, and Children Youth and Families) to deliver the best service for our residents
* To ensure that residents receive services relevant to their needs, arising from their Outcome Star assessment action plans
* Responsibility for monitoring clients welfare, including physical and mental health, substance misuse and to intervene with appropriate strategies as required.
* To work alongside the progression team to support residents to engage in Education, Training & Employment
* Maximising housing occupancy and minimising voids by taking proactive action
* Ensure that residents comply with Tenancy and License conditions, and taking action to deal with any anti-social behaviour as instructed by the Housing and Support Manager
